Summary
A letter writer to the Seattle Post-Intelligencer, a sergeant in the Marines, mentioned how, while many are doing their patriotic duties, some are taking advantage of the war such as price gouging, and even harming helpless people such as the Japanese American women who were forced to resign as school clerks because of their race.
Title
Sergeant Speaking
Author
Logan, Sergeant J.J.
Publisher
Seattle Post-Intelligencer
Date
03/13/42
